This study is based on two studies by the Center for Monitoring the Impact of Peace (CMIP) based on 500 Israeli school textbooks for the years 1999-2000 and 2001-2002: language, literature, communication, history, geography, civic education, religious education and interdisciplinary subjects in all grades from kindergarten to 12th grade. The CMIP wishes to identify and present all the references, directly or indirectly, to the image of the “other”, more precisely that of Muslims, Arabs and Palestinians, in Israeli textbooks. The results of our survey corroborate the findings of our predecessors, and confirms their observation of a radical shift in the content of textbooks from the mid-1980s, which highlights a preparation for coexistence with Arabs and Palestinians.
